4 Current Situation Industry leaders in Wireless CompanyRogersBellTelus Market Share37%30%28% Subscribers8.5 Million6.8 Million6.5 Million 3 rd place in Internet CompanyBellShawRogers Market Share21%19%16% Subscribers2 Million1.9 million1.6 Million

5 Market Leaders in Wireless Internet Lag Behind in Television Landline Telephone Media

6 Emerging industry Growth of 1.5% to 1.8% every year Data usage (Smartphone)

7 More than half of the revenues come from wireless. Year2006200720082009 % of revenues contributed from wireless 52%54%56%57% Number of subscribers 6,778,0007,338,0007,942,0008,494,000

8 Third largest with a market penetration of 16% Opportunity for growth Gain a higher market share

9 Revenue from internet has increased by 5% over the last 5 years. The number of subscribers has increased from 1.3 million to 1.6 million.

16 Growth in wireless Wireless penetration in Canada is expected to grow by approximately four to five percentage points each year. 37% (Market share of Rogers) * 4% = 1.5% 37% * 5% = 1.9 % Therefore, Rogers is expected to grow by 1.5 to 1.9% every year.

17 Data Usage (Smartphone's) 31% of all Rogers customers use smart phones in 200963% increase in 2009 from 2008(31% - 19%) / 19% = 63%19% in 2008 63% increase in 2009 from 2008 (31% - 19%) / 19% = 63%
